  • Panasonic WJ-NV200K, 34 35 About captured images When the captured image button (☞ page 26) is clicked to display data saved on SD memory card on a PC, the data format and destination to save are as follows: File format for recorded images: JPEG (DPOF-compatible) Destination to save: SD memory card [DCIM]\100_PANA\ P1000001.JPG P1000002.JPG, ... * The folder will be created from 100_PANA to 999_PANA. If the folder already contains the file P1000999. JPG, a folder with a new number will be created.

  • Panasonic WJ-NV200K, 4 5 Preface The network disk recorders WJ-NV200K and WJ-NV200K/G (hereinafter, recorders) are designed for use within a surveillance system, and record images/audio from up to 16 network cameras (hereinafter, cameras) on the hard disk drives. Up to 16 cameras can be registered. This recorder supports HDMI (High-Definition Multimedia Interface) standard which allows displaying playback/ live images with superior quality when connecting to a high-definition monitor using an HDMI cable (option). Play the copied/downloaded recorded images When recorded images are copied/downloaded, recorded images and audio will be copied/downloaded as an image data file (filename.n3r) and an audio data file (filename.n3a) respectively into the copy/download destina- tion. It is possible to play, save and print the copied/downloaded data files using the dedicated viewer software.   • Panasonic WJ-NV200K, 6 7 Before using this product Face matching function Face recognition refers to a function that uses a connected camera supporting this function to detect facial fea- tures of people and matches them against similar facial features recorded earlier or contained in live images. The matching accuracy varies depending on installation, settings and adjustment of the camera, ambient envi- ronment and object.
